Travel / Re: GENERAL Irish (student)visa & Work Permit-New THREAD*** by Chibabe4Christ: 2:54pm On Sep 04, 2020
Thank you...

I had to open euro account and transfer 7045 euro because they will subtract some charges from the money so if you send 7000euro the money will not be up to 7000euro after removing some charges and that will reflect on the receipt they will give, Remember Irish embassy demands we pay 7000euro for EDUBOND.
I hope I answered the question

Travel / Re: GENERAL Irish (student)visa & Work Permit-New THREAD*** by Chibabe4Christ: 1:32pm On Sep 03, 2020
Thank you very much
My first application was for February intake so I submitted in October 2019.
Got refused in December 2019
Appealed that same December 2019
because of covid, I didn't hear anything from them even when I sent several mail, notting from the embassy so I lost hope since they were not answering. To my greatest surprise my visa was approved 2nd week embassy was opened in July and I got my kpali in August hahhahaaa....
It can only be GOD ooooo

NOTE: For those that are appealing, if you think you are behind the scheduled time for your academic session, do not be in a hurry, you can request for a new offer letter for the next academic session from your international officer so that VO will will not capitalise on the reason that your school will soon start to deny you again.
That was what I did in my own case. My initial application was for February intake but I got a new offer letter and invitation to register for September intake, appealed and got approved.

I hope this helps

For those that their visa were denied, am truly sorry about that but the truth is that I was once in that terrible mood when I was denied. I felt the world has collapsed on me but little did I know that it was the will of GOD.
What do I mean? My first application was 101% ok. I submitted everything even added extra documents to prove my transparency. My financial aspect was clearly stated. I had enough money left after i have paid my school fees, I presented my letter of employment, my pay slips, letter of recommendation from our HR..... Infact my statement of account I printed corresponded with my pay slips and inflow/outflow of money was 101% consistence. All the reasons for their denial were funny because they were part of the evidence I presented. Eg My financial status, date of birth (Note: I have never used another date of birth since my childhood, my WAEC result has my original date of birth crested on it, my birth certificate from NCC, my baptizmal card looking old you will clearly know that it was not forged in all they said I gave a fake date of birth... hahahaha. The ONLY thing I did not do was EDUBOND. So when I was apealing I used EDUBOND, immigration lawyer in Nigeria and presented all documents I submitted earlier according to the way it was stated in IRISH website.
Finally a decision was made and my visa was APPROVED.
My point is that GOD allowed the denial to take place so that I can apply for EDUBOND and doesn't have to be stranded. The exchange rate when I did the EDUBOND was N395 per 1 euro from black market against N552 per 1euro currently.
It has added extra 1million Naira.
